Online Class Availability at Pennsylvania State University-Main Campus
Many students take online classes at Pennsylvania State University-Main Campus. Among 50,737 students, 321 (1%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 20,178 (40%) took at least some classes online.

Public Relations & Advertising Bachelor’s Program at Pennsylvania State University-Main Campus
Among the 320 bachelor’s public relations & advertising degrees awarded at Pennsylvania State University-Main Campus, 85% were women (273) and 15% were men (47).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Public Relations & Advertising bachelor’s degree recipients at Pennsylvania State University-Main Campus.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 226 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 18 |
| Black / African American | 10 |
| Asian | 12 |
| Two or More Races | 12 |
| International (Nonresident) | 38 |
| Unknown | 4 |
Minority students account for 16% of Public Relations & Advertising bachelor’s degree recipients at Pennsylvania State University-Main Campus, below the national average of 32%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
